Texiguat Biological Reserve
Texiguat Biological Reserve is a reserve in Francisco Morazán Department, Honduras and has an elevation of 809 metres. Texiguat Biological Reserve is situated nearby to the neighborhood San Francisco, as well as near the locality Santa Inés.| Tap on a place to explore it |

San Antonio de Oriente is a municipality in the Honduran department of Francisco Morazán. Population as of 2015 is 15,299. The first occupants came in 1660 in the village Mineral de San Antonio that is 4 km away from the present town. San Antonio de Oriente is situated 9 km northwest of Texiguat Biological Reserve.
